Must work differently than the Rough Country Speedometer Calibrator then because I plugged into the one furthest from the seat and it worked fine.

I would talk to AEV first as some have had issues that required a tow to the dealer to get sorted and now that there is the warning they probably won't pay for the repair or tow. You can down load the instructions from AEV's site. They mention only one green star connector and in fact there is two green star connectors on 2020's and it needs to be plugged into the one closes to you which is also a little wider. My buddy first plugged into the one closer to the fire wall as the instructions say it does not matter which slot. He came over and looked at mine and plugged into the same slot and all worked fine. He did have his check engine light on for an hour or so but it went out and never came back. I found AEV very helpful so I would call them first and see what they say. Also on the instructions there is a tech number to call and I would call them before trying to program with it.
